Delta Crash: Passengers Offered $30,000 in Compensation โ What You Need to Know
A Delta Air Lines flight experienced a hard landing at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port, leaving passengers shaken and prompting the airline to offer compensation. The incident, which involved a Delta flight from Atlanta to New York, resulted in injuries and significant damage to the aircraft. While the exact details are still emerging, the airline's offer of $30,000 to each passenger raises questions about the severity of the event and the legal implications. This article delves deeper into the Delta crash, the compensation offered, and what this means for affected passengers.
The Delta Crash: A Closer Look
The hard landing wasn't just a bumpy arrival; reports suggest a forceful impact that resulted in injuries to passengers and significant damage to the aircraft. Emergency services were swiftly deployed, and passengers were treated for various injuries ranging from minor bruises to more serious conditions. While Delta has yet to release a full statement detailing the cause of the hard landing, initial reports suggest potential issues with the landing gear or runway conditions. Investigations are underway by both the airline and the National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) to determine the precise cause of the incident. Further information is expected to be released as the investigation progresses. The focus is not only on determining the cause but also on ensuring such events are prevented in the future.
